    In this video I show how to set up the timing correctly on a 1.6 litre & 1.8 litre engines in the following vehicles,
    2007 - 2010 Holden Astra 1.8 i (AH)
    2011 - Holden Barina 1.6 i (TM)
    2012 - Holden Barina 1.6 i (TM)
    2013 - 2016 Holden Cruze 1.6 Turbo (JH)
    2009 - 2011 Chevrolet Cruze 1.8 (JG)
    2011 - 2016 Holden Cruze 1.8 (JH)
    2014 - Holden Trax 1.8 (TJ) SUV
    2005 - 2009 Holden Viva 1.8 i (JF)
    2012 - 2015 Opel Astra 1.6 Turbo (PJ)
    2012 - 2013 Opel Corsa 1.6 Turbo
    Opel Mokka
    Vauxhall/Opel Astra-H (04-13) 1.4 1.6
    Other Applications:
    Vauxhall: Astra, Corsa, Insignia, Meriva, Signum, Vectra, Zafira
    Chevrolet: Cruze, Orlando 1.4, 1.6, 1.8
    Fiat: Croma 1.8 16V
    Alfa Romeo: 159 with 939A4.000 engines

      It had no fault code stored, the adjustment of the timing was made on the camshaft adjusters (I removed the timing belt)
      The outer cap needs to be removed and then the camshaft adjuster sprocket can be moved once the bolt is loosed on the camshaft. (camshaft sprockets have no locating keyway on the cams)
      If you are just doing the timing belt it is very unlikely you will need to make any adjustments like that unless previously done incorrectly.
